Search jobs > Boucherville, QC > Temporary > Embedded software engineer

Embedded Software Engineer

Actalent
Boucherville, Quebec, Canada
$45-$65 an hour
Full-time

JOB DESCRIPTION

Description :

They are developing electric vehicle motors and related power systems . They develop a new generation of inverters. Design to do to respect A-Spice standards in the automotive industry.

Design and embedded development with C (10%) and C++(90%)

Implementation,

Testing and debugging of embedded software for automotive electronics module

Design from requirements - 20%

Software Development - 20%

Support Architecture - 20%

Documentation - 20%

Testing - 20%

FROM JD :

Analyze, design, develop & testing of software components to ASPICE / ISO / AGILE methodology & standards.

Work closely with the electronics and hardware departments to ensure design of electronics and hardware can support the software requirements.

Support Architecture design and development.

Create details designs to link the software implementation to the requirements.

Develop software code in C++ to implement the software design.

Conduct unit test to validate the software implementation.

Support issue analysis and corrective action definitions.

Take part in various development in the software development life cycle.

Skills :

c++, embedded development, v-cycle, Aurix, SafeTPack, embedded software, microcontroller, rtos, electronics, automotive engineering, embedded system, microprocessor, python, iso, freertos, Infineon Aurix TCx, Aurix TC3, bitfield

Top Skills Details :

c++,embedded development,v-cycle,Aurix,SafeTPack

Additional Skills & Qualifications :

MUST :

5 years of experience with Embedded development C++ with RTOS (32-bit microcontrollers)

2 years of experience with low level device driver development, such as Flash, ADC, EEPROM, LIN, CANFD, SPI

V-Cycle development

Aurix TC3x

SafeTPack

Hitex

Experience developing software in accordance with a formal V-based software development process (based on ASPICE).

MUST Screening Questions

Bare metal - What experience do you have with bare metal development in terms of drivers (SPI, FLASH, ADC) development ?

Not using drivers but participating in the development.

Activities - What experience do you have writing software requirements? with Architecture using UML? Documentation?

V-Cycle - Have you worked in a V-cycle environment (A-Spice)?

Important Concepts :

Understand drivers and what they control, experience around development of drivers

Firmware concepts, code performance, specs around microcontrollers

OK candidate if RTOS, understand drivers and microcontrollers, automotive,

ASSET : BITFIELD

BITFIELD

Infineon Aurix TCx

SafeRTOS, FreeRTOS, UC / OS

Simulink Test (MIL / SIL)

Embedded systems testing with MIL, SIL, PIL.

Python

SPI, CAN, CANFD, J, UDS, and XCP communication protocols

TOOLS : Polarion

Polarion

MBD : Matlab / Simulink + Toolbox (Simulink Requirements, Simulink Tests, etc.)

Software devOps tools : Jira, ,Azure Git, CMake, Artifactory, etc.

Static code analysis tools : Polyspace, etc.

Software unit testing and software integration testing : VectorCAST, etc.

LauterBach debugger

Automotive communication tools (Vector Canape, CANalyzer / CANoe, & CANdela)

Experience Level : Intermediate Leve

Intermediate Leve

À propos d'Actalent :

Actalent est un chef de file mondial des services d’ingénierie et de sciences et des solutions de talents. Nous aidons les entreprises visionnaires à faire progresser leurs initiatives en matière d’ingénierie et de science en leur donnant accès à des experts spécialisés qui favorisent la mise à l’échelle, l’innovation et la mise en marché rapide.

Avec un réseau de près de 30 consultants et plus de 4 clients aux États-Unis, au Canada, en Asie et en Europe, Actalent est au service d’un grand nombre d’entreprises du classement Fortune .

La diversité, l’équité et l’inclusion

Chez Actalent, la diversité et l’inclusion constituent le pont vers l’équité et la réussite de notre personnel. La diversité, l’équité et l’inclusion (DE&I) sont ancrées dans notre culture par :

  • L’embauche des talents diversifiés ;
  • Le maintien d’un environnement inclusif par une autoréflexion permanente ;
  • La mise en place d’une culture de soin, d’engagement, et de reconnaissance par des résultats concrets ;
  • L’assurance des opportunités de croissance pour nos gens.

Actalent est un employeur souscrivant au principe de l’égalité des chances et accepte toutes les candidatures sans tenir compte de la race, du sexe, de l’âge, de la couleur, de la religion, des origines nationales, du statut d’ancien combattant, d’un handicap, de l’orientation sexuelle, de l’identité sexuelle, des renseignements génétiques ou de toute autre caractéristique protégée par la loi.

Si vous souhaitez faire une demande d’accommodement raisonnable, tel que la modification ou l’ajustement du processus de demande d’emploi ou d’entrevue à cause d’un handicap, veuillez envoyer un courriel à pour connaître d’autres options d’accommodement.

Numéro du permis d'agence de placement de personnel : AP- (Canada Québec)

Numéro du permis d'agence de recrutement de travailleurs étrangers temporaires : AR- (Canada Québec)

About Actalent

Actalent is a global leader in engineering and sciences services and talent solutions. We help visionary companies advance their engineering and science initiatives through access to specialized experts who drive scale, innovation and speed to market.

With a network of almost 30, consultants and more than 4, clients across the U.S., Canada, Asia and Europe, Actalent serves many of the Fortune .

Diversity, Equity & Inclusion

At Actalent, diversity and inclusion are a bridge towards the equity and success of our people. DE&I are embedded into our culture through :

  • Hiring diverse talent
  • Maintaining an inclusive environment through persistent self-reflection
  • Building a culture of care, engagement, and recognition with clear outcomes
  • Ensuring growth opportunities for our people

The company is an equal opportunity employer and will consider all applications without regard to race, sex, age, color, religion, national origin, veteran status, disability, sexual orientation, gender identity, genetic information or any characteristic protected by law.

If you would like to request a reasonable accommodation, such as the modification or adjustment of the job application process or interviewing process due to a disability, please email for other accommodation options.

Personnel Placement Agency Permit Number : AP- (Canada Quebec)

Temporary Foreign Worker Recruitment Agency Permit Number : AR- (Canada Quebec)

30+ days ago
Related jobs
Actalent
Boucherville, Quebec
Full-time

0 )Implementation, Testing and debugging of embedded software for automotive electronics moduleDesign.. AR. (Canada. Québec) About Actalent Actalent is a global leader in engineering and sciences services..

Promoted
New!
Neptronic
Montreal, Quebec
Full-time

Titre. Développeur de logiciel embarqué temps réel Pourquoi Neptronic? Depuis 1976, Neptronic conçoit et fabrique des produits pour l'industrie du chauffage, de la ventilation et d..

FTEX
Montreal, Quebec
Full-time +1

Your role as a Firmware Engineer at FTEX is key to establishing ourselves as leaders in Quebec's EV.. Work with the hardware team to develop procedures to find hardware and software bugs. Provide systems..

Promoted
Savoir-faire Linux
Montreal, Quebec
Full-time

As a Senior Embedded Software Engineer, you will have the opportunity to own and drive portions of the.. Participate in software system architecture development and document software requirements and..

Boston Scientific
Montreal, Quebec
Full-time

As a Senior Embedded Software Engineer, you will have the opportunity to own and drive portions of the.. Participate in software system architecture development and document software requirements and..

CS GROUP
Montreal, Quebec
Full-time

Job DescriptionWe are looking for a Embedded Software Developer to join a dynamic and multidisciplinary.. Ability to communicate with multi disciplinary stakeholders (system engineers, hardware engineers..

Grass Valley
Montreal, Quebec
Quick Apply
Full-time

As a Software Engineer, you will be instrumental in the design, development, and testing of embedded system solutions tailored for broadcast video and audio applicationsYour RoleContribute..

Promoted
New!
Lisplogics
Montreal, Quebec
Full-time

Days of in office collaboration with the team. Role Overview. Software Engineer (Bilingual. Real Time.. Real Time Systems) We are in search of a Software Engineer who not only excels in the development of..

ARA Robotics
Montreal, Quebec
Full-time

Java. Skills Required. Experience in Java Scala development. Sound knowledge of Spring and SpringBoot. Exposure to Restful APIs. Understanding of Database concepts and SQL. Stored ..

Promoted
Genpact
Montreal, Quebec
Full-time

Job Tile. Data Engineer Location. Montreal, CANADA Duration. Full time role With a startup spirit and.. Inviting applications for the role of Data Engineer Job Responsibilities. The team is looking for..